Repair of the ignition Cylinder

The ignition cylinder could be the cause of your key not turning or inserted into your ignition. This small part makes sure only the correct key is used to start the vehicle. It is comprised of a series of pins and tumblers that lock and unlock when the key is moved through a specific sequence in the ignition switch. If the tumblers become damaged or stuck, they will stop the key from going all the way into the ignition switch and from being removed.

If the ignition cylinder is having problems, it's essential to have it replaced as fast as possible. This can protect your vehicle from being taken by leaving it in the "On" position. It will ensure that you won't experience any issues starting your engine or using accessories like the radio or power windows.

To replace the ignition cylinder, it is necessary to disassemble it. This procedure will differ based on the manufacturer. Depending on the model, you may have to take off the steering wheel, wiper switch and other interior components to gain access to the ignition switch. Once the cylinder for ignition has been removed from the switch it is depressed using a screwdriver. Once all push pins have been depressed and fasteners removed, the new cylinder can be installed.

Key Fob Replacement

It can be a major problem when a key fob doesn't work. It could stop you from getting into or starting your car and it's crucial to have a spare in case this occurs.

If your Nissan's key fob isn't working, the first thing to do is determine if it's just a matter of replacing the battery. You can buy these at hardware stores or big-box retailers, and are usually cheap. There are also a number of YouTube videos from users who explain how to replace a fob battery, and the procedure is usually simple and quick.

However, if your vehicle isn't responding to your key fob, it might have a problem with its internal programming components and this will require expert assistance. A key fob could be blocked by a strong signal from a mobile phone, radio or TV tower or other electrical devices.

Transponder Key Replacement

Many vehicles built in the mid-to-late 1990s are equipped with transponder chips in the key fobs, as well as the blade that goes into the ignition. The transponder transmits a digital signal to the receiver within the vehicle when the key is hit. If this isn't the correct code and the engine doesn't start, it won't. If you lose your keyfob you'll require a key with a transponder to start your car.

The replacement key could include a microchip, based on the model of your car. This is a higher-tech technology and will cost more to replace in the event that you lose it. It is possible to cover this under the warranty or insurance policy of the vehicle, however you'll have to visit the dealer to purchase and program the replacement.

If your vehicle is equipped with this technology, you'll need to locate a professional who knows what they're doing and has the tools to do so correctly.
